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al in Reisterstown, MD

Don’t let the signs of a pool leak go unnoticed, early detection can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your property.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ent, unpleasant odor coming from your pool or surrounding areas, it’s likely a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t ignore it, address the issue before it worsens.

Soft or Spongy Spots on Your Property

Soft or spongy spots on your lawn, walls, or other structures can show water damage from a pool leak. Don’t delay, inspect your property and contact us for professional help.

Increased Water Bills

A sudden spike in your water bills could be a sign of a hidden pool leak. Don’t attribute it to anything else, investigate further and contact us for a thorough inspection.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as cracks in walls or ceilings, can be a clear indication of a pool leak. Don’t wait until it’s too late, contact us for immediate help.

Pool Leak Water Removal Cost in Reisterstown, MD

The cost of pool le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in Reisterstown, MD.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Pool leak assessment and repair $500-$1,500 Size of affected area, complexity of repairs, and local labor costs
Water extraction and cleanup $200-$1,000 Amount of water extracted, equipment used, and labor costs
Structural damage repairs $1,000-$3,000 Complexity of repairs, materials used, and labor costs

What Causes Pool Leaks?

Pool le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including improper installation, worn-out equipment, and environmental factors like soil movement and freezing temperatures. Don’t let these factors catch you off guard, be proactive and address any issues before they worsen.
